Site icon PHP India

MySQL: Powering Web Development with Robust Databases

Web Development with MySQL

MySQL is a popular open-source relational database management system that plays a crucial role in powering web development projects. From small websites to large-scale web applications, MySQL provides a reliable and efficient solution for storing and retrieving data. In this article, we will explore the key features and benefits of MySQL in web development.

Why Choose MySQL for Web Development?

MySQL is a preferred choice for web developers for several reasons:

Key Features of MySQL for Web Development

1. Data Security

MySQL provides robust security features to protect your data from unauthorized access. This includes user authentication, access control, and encryption of sensitive information. By implementing proper security measures, you can ensure the confidentiality and integrity of your data.

2. Data Integrity

MySQL enforces data integrity through constraints, triggers, and foreign key relationships. This helps maintain the consistency and accuracy of your data, preventing errors and inconsistencies in your web application.

3. Performance Optimization

MySQL offers various tools and techniques for optimizing the performance of your database. This includes indexing, query optimization, and caching mechanisms to ensure fast and efficient data retrieval.

4. Scalability Options

MySQL provides options for scaling your database infrastructure as your web application grows. This includes sharding, clustering, and replication to distribute the workload and handle increased traffic effectively.

5. Community Support

MySQL has a large and active community of developers and users who contribute to its development and provide support. You can find extensive documentation, tutorials, and forums to help you troubleshoot issues and optimize your use of MySQL in web development.

Conclusion

MySQL is a powerful and versatile database management system that is well-suited for web development projects of all sizes. With its scalability, performance, reliability, and security features, MySQL enables developers to build robust and efficient web applications. By leveraging the key features and benefits of MySQL, you can create dynamic and data-driven websites that meet the demands of modern web development.

Considering using MySQL for your next web development project? We can help! Contact us for a free consultation.

FAQs:

1. What makes MySQL a preferred choice for web developers?

MySQL is preferred for web development due to its scalability, performance, reliability, and compatibility with various programming languages and frameworks.

2. How does MySQL ensure data security in web development?

MySQL provides robust security features such as user authentication, access control, and encryption of sensitive information to protect data from unauthorized access.

3. How does MySQL maintain data integrity in web applications?

MySQL enforces data integrity through constraints, triggers, and foreign key relationships, ensuring consistency and accuracy of data in web applications.

4. What scalability options does MySQL offer for web development projects?

MySQL provides options like sharding, clustering, and replication to help scale database infrastructure as web applications grow and handle increased traffic effectively.

Exit mobile version